Output 6e61d38d76077b58031f5f3bd06df3d2e9986deb5188e44e6b1ae7e1ac39dabb:3

value
32404319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ff144784a423429cc3ffd69f8ac5bd1c9a73d1b9 OP_EQUAL
address
3QwkXVhipC7MGjr5meRgU7sL9fVZQohehB
transaction
6e61d38d76077b58031f5f3bd06df3d2e9986deb5188e44e6b1ae7e1ac39dabb
confirmations
323922
spent
true